“ Study abroad is the single most effective way of changing the way we view the world. ” Presently, the number of Indian students studying abroad has increased. As per reports, around 1.8 million Indian students are expected to spend $85 billion on overseas education by 2024. A major reason for this rise is the global professional opportunities offered by international universities.
